L-type Ca(2+) current as the predominant pathway of Ca(2+) entry during I(Na) activation in β-stimulated cardiac myocytes
1. In the present study Ca(2+) entry via different voltage-dependent membrane channels was examined with a fluorescent Ca(2+) indicator before and after β-adrenergic stimulation. 2.
